Sr. Software Development Engineer

Micron TechnologyBoise, ID
1d

About The Position

Coordinate tool automation and host enhancements by partnering with automation developers and domain experts to deliver projects on schedule Gather, prioritize, and document requirements for new automation systems and enhancements across 300mm fabs globally Test and support manufacturing and automation software releases, including upgrades and resiliency improvements Troubleshoot and resolve automation and software issues in a daily support role, including 24x7 on-call rotation Maintain user documentation and provide regular project status reporting to management

Requirements

  • Bachelor's or Master's degree in Computer Science, Engineering, or a related technical field
  • Minimum of 5 years of hands-on experience as a software developer in enterprise software development, implementations, and support
  • Hands-on experience with object-oriented programming and software development lifecycle practices
  • Experience working in an Agile/Scrum development environment
  • Software testing experience in a manufacturing or automation environment
  • Strong analytical, written, and verbal communication skills with the ability to handle multiple priorities
  • Experience supporting or integrating automation systems in a semiconductor or manufacturing environment
  • Knowledge of software architecture, system integration, and automation tool frameworks
  • Experience crafting user documentation and training materials for software releases
  • Proven ability to solve complex software and automation issues across multiple systems
  • Experience supporting global or multi-site operations with standardized reporting and metrics

Responsibilities

  • Coordinate tool automation and host enhancements
  • Partner with automation developers and domain experts to deliver projects on schedule
  • Gather, prioritize, and document requirements for new automation systems and enhancements across 300mm fabs globally
  • Test and support manufacturing and automation software releases, including upgrades and resiliency improvements
  • Troubleshoot and resolve automation and software issues in a daily support role, including 24x7 on-call rotation
  • Maintain user documentation
  • Provide regular project status reporting to management
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service